Introduction to Raspberry Leaf Tea

Raspberry leaf tea, derived from the leaves of the red raspberry plant, has been used for centuries as a natural remedy and women’s health tonic. It is renowned for its various health benefits, particularly for women during different stages of their lives.

The Benefits of Raspberry Leaf Tea

– **Menstrual Health:** Raspberry leaf tea is well-known for its ability to ease menstrual cramps and regulate periods due to its muscle-relaxing properties.
– **Pregnancy Support:** Many pregnant women turn to raspberry leaf tea to help tone the uterus, potentially aiding in smoother labor and delivery.
– **Postpartum Recovery:** After childbirth, this tea can assist in uterine recovery and milk production in nursing mothers.
– **Hormone Balance:** Raspberry leaf tea may help balance hormones, supporting overall reproductive health in women.

How to Prepare Raspberry Leaf Tea

To make raspberry leaf tea, steep 1-2 teaspoons of dried raspberry leaves in hot water for 10-15 minutes. You can enjoy it hot or cold, sweetened or unsweetened, depending on personal preference.

When to Avoid Raspberry Leaf Tea

Although considered safe for most women, it’s advisable to avoid raspberry leaf tea in the first trimester of pregnancy. It’s always best to consult with a healthcare provider before incorporating it into your routine, especially if you have specific health conditions or concerns.

FAQ About Raspberry Leaf Tea

What is Raspberry Leaf Tea?

Raspberry leaf tea is an herbal infusion made from the leaves of the raspberry plant, known for its various health benefits, particularly for women’s health.

How is Raspberry Leaf Tea Beneficial for Women’s Health?

Raspberry leaf tea is believed to help in toning the uterus, supporting reproductive health, easing menstrual cramps, and aiding in a smoother labor and childbirth process.

Can Raspberry Leaf Tea be Consumed During Pregnancy?

Many women use raspberry leaf tea during their third trimester to potentially strengthen the uterus for labor. However, it’s important to consult with a healthcare provider before consuming it during pregnancy.

How Does Raspberry Leaf Tea Taste?

Raspberry leaf tea has a mild, slightly earthy taste with subtle herbal notes. Some people find it enjoyable on its own, while others prefer to mix it with honey or other natural sweeteners.

Is Raspberry Leaf Tea Safe to Drink Daily?

Raspberry leaf tea is generally considered safe for most people when consumed in moderate amounts. It’s best to start with a small dosage and gradually increase it to assess any potential reactions.
